CSS通过name获取值
CSS是一种用于样式表布局的语言,它可以用于更改网页中的元素的外观和属性。通过name属性,CSS可以获取元素的值,以便对其样式进行更具体的设置。在本文中,我们将探讨如何使用name属性来获取元素的值。
让我们来创建一个HTML元素,并为其添加一个name属性:
```html
然后,我们可以使用CSS来更改该元素的样式,如下所示:
```css
#myDiv {
width: 200px;
height: 200px;
background-color: blue;
现在,如果我们想要获取该元素的值,我们可以使用name属性:
```html
这样,我们就能够使用CSS的#myDiv规则来更改该元素的样式,而不仅仅是id为myDiv的规则:
```css
#myDiv {
width: 200px;
height: 200px;
background-color: blue;
#myDiv:hover {
background-color: green;
通过name属性,我们可以更具体地设置CSS规则,以便更好地控制元素的样式。
除了获取元素的值外,name属性还可以用于设置元素的其他属性,如class属性:
```html
Hello, World!
现在,我们可以使用CSS来更改该元素的样式,如下所示:
```css
#myDiv {
width: 200px;
height: 200px;
background-color: blue;
#myDiv.text {
font-size: 20px;
#myDiv:hover {
background-color: green;
这样,我们就能够使用CSS.text属性来更改该元素中的文本样式,而不仅仅是id为myDiv和id为text的规则:
总之,name属性是CSS中用于获取和设置元素的值的一种重要属性。通过name属性,我们可以更具体地控制元素的样式,从而更好地优化网页布局。